MILWAUKEE (CBS 58) -- It's the little things that matter most to new parents, a child's first smile, their first laugh, but when the basic needs of a newborn are hard to come by those little things can seem like the least important thing in life.
That's where a new organization in Milwaukee is aiming to help, connecting new moms to the vital necessities of motherhood during a time of struggle for so many.
On CB S58 Sunday Morning, Brittany Lewis met the leaders behind the Milwaukee Diaper Mission.
